Affordability
TIP:Try to keep your rent within a third of your gross household income. Learn why in our Renter's Guide.
For this property
$48,600 PER YEAR
is the suggested income
Win over prospective landlords with your smart budgeting. As a good rule of thumb, ideally you would have at least three times your monthly rent in combined household income.
